What is the cheapest month to fly from London to Entebbe?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from London to Entebbe,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from London to Entebbe is November, where tickets cost £505 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are July and August,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is £742 and £710 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from London to Entebbe?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from London to Entebbe,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from London to Entebbe, you should book around 2 weeks before departure, which saves you about 18% compared to booking last min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 22 weeks before departure.

FAQs for booking flights from London to Entebbe

  • Are there any hotels at Entebbe Airport?

    No, Entebbe Airport does not have any onsite hotels. However, Airport View Hotel and Executive Airport Hotel and Protea Hotel by Marriott Entebbe are three accommodation options close to the airport (less than 15min) with complimentary return airport transfers available to arriving guests.

  • Where can I get some local currency at Entebbe Airport?

    There are offices of Jetset Forex Bureau where you can make currency exchange transactions and Orient Bank which can handle other financial matters in the main Arrivals Hall at Entebbe Airport. You can also find a few ATMs, including Barclays and Eco Bank, in the Arrivals Hall. All locations are open 24h a day, 7 days a week.

  • Is there a medical facility at Entebbe Airport?

    Yes. Entebbe Airport has an Airport Medical Centre located on the ground floor, landside of the Arrivals Hall, which can handle medical emergencies and provide first aid when required. The facility also has a pharmacy, laboratory and outpatient services and is open 24h a day, 7 days a week.

  • What other regions are accessible from Entebbe Airport?

    Entebbe Airport the country’s main air hub ad is located about 25 miles outside of Kampala, the nation’s capital near Lake Victoria. The airport serves the Kampala metropolitan area, which includes neighbouring districts of Wakiso (31 miles), Mukono (29 miles), and Mpigi (17 miles) from the airport.

  • What visa do I need when I arrive at Entebbe Airport?

    UK citizens need a visa to enter Uganda, which will not be issued at the airport. This means you must apply at the Ugandan High Commission prior to travelling. You must also ensure your passport has six months of validity left on it from the date of entry.

KAYAK’s top tips for finding a cheap flight from London to Entebbe

  • Looking for a cheap flight from London to Entebbe? 25% of our users found flights on this route for £557 or less one-way and £729 or less round-trip.
  • Several airlines provide a one-stop service from London area airports to Entebbe Airport (EBB). Ethiopian Air has flights from London Heathrow Airport (LHR) with stops at Addis Ababa Bole Int’l Airport (ADD), while flights on Qatar Airways stop at Doha Hamad Int’l Airport (DOH). Turkish Airlines flights from London Gatwick stop over at Istanbul Airport (IST) en route to Uganda.
  • If you’re departing London Stansted (STN) to Entebbe and you wish to park and fly, the airport has several attractive options to consider. Mid Stay, Long Stay and JetParks offer low-cost rates online, and the airport provides free shuttle bus transfers to the terminal. Short Stay parking is less than a 5min walk from the terminal, so no transport is necessary.
  • For families with infants or young children using London City Airport (LCY), there are Baby changing facilities are located in both the men's and women's toilets near Café Nero and in the First Aid Room in the main terminal concourse, which also accommodates breastfeeding facilities. If you have toddlers, there is a play area between Gates 5 and 6 where they can pass some time until your boarding call.
  • Need to pick up some last-minute toiletries or over the counter medications? There is a Boots chemist after security at London City Airport, where you can replace the toothbrush you left at home and pick up some travel accessories like a neck or back pillow and eye mask or ear buds to make your flight more comfortable and enjoyable.
  • If you have the time, you can enjoy table service with complimentary food, beverages and free Wi-Fi at one of the lounges in London Gatwick Airport (LGW). Club Aspire operates locations in both North and South Terminals from about £25 per person. You can also find No1 Lounge locations at both terminals, where prices start at about £32 per person.
  • You can fly from five London airports to Entebbe International Airport (EBB), all of which offer accessible features such as disabled toilets and hidden disability assistance via the Sunflower Lanyard scheme. If you need one-on-one help getting around the airport, you can request this from your airline at least 48 hours before you fly.
  • When you get flights from London to Entebbe, you can travel to the departure terminals easily. Heathrow Airport (LHR) has the Heathrow Express from Paddington. You can get to Gatwick Airport (LGW) via the Gatwick Express from Victoria. There is the Stansted Express from Liverpool Street that goes to Stansted Airport (STN), whereas you can get the DLR from West Ham to London City Airport (LCY) or the Thameslink Railway from St Pancras International to Luton Airport (LTN).
